پشتیبانی و استقرار سیستم‎ها‎‎ی نرم افزاری

پشتیبانی سیستم‎ها‎‎ی نرم افزاری چیست؟

زمانی که یک نرم افزار تولید می‎شود، برای عرضه به مشتری، نیازمند فردی است تا بتواند بر مراحل نصب و قابلیت‎ها‎‎ی برنامه مسلط شود که این فراد به مشتری کمک می‎نماید تا از نرم افزار تولید شده بخوبی استفاده و در صورت مواجهه با خطا و یا در خواست قابلیت جدید، درخواست آنان را به تیم تولید منتقل می‎دهد.

فرآیند پشتیبانی و استقرار سیستم‎ها‎‎ی نرم افزاری

فرایند پشتیبانی از سرویس نرم افزاری، به مراتب مهم‎تر از تهیه و راه اندازی اولیه آن سرویس در سازمان می‎باشد زیرا قبل از ورود یک نرم افزار، سازمان به شکلی نیاز خود را تامین می‎کند اما پس از ورود نرم افزار جدید، فرآیندهای خود را به تناسب آن تغییر داده و در گردش کار خود به آن سرویس وابسته می‎گردد، بنابراین نیاز به یک کارشناس پشتیبان و استقرار ضروری می‎باشد.

خدمات پشتیبانی نرم افزار شامل رفع خطاهای احتمالی نرم افزار، ارائه آموزش‌های موردی و رفع اشکال کاربران، مشاوره امنیتی سرور، ارائه وصله‌های نرم افزاری بهبود دهنده، ارائه مشاوره و راهنمایی جهت بهره‌برداری بهینه از سیستم، ارائه نسخه ها‎‎ی ارتقاء یافته نرم افزار به صورت رایگان و همکاری در بازیابی سیستم در صورت خرابی می‎باشد.

نرم افزارهای تولید شده در زمینه ها‎‎ی مختلف صنعتی، اداری، حسابداری و … تولید می‎شوند از همین رو مهارت‎ها‎‎ و وظایف پشتیبان‌ها نیز متنوع است. به دلیل گستردگی این شغل، هر یک از کارشناسان پشتیبانی و استقرار در یک حوزه تخصص دارند. برای مثال برخی از کارشناسان در حوزه بازرگانی از جمله فروش، انبارداری و تدارکات و برخی دیگر در حوزه اتوماسیون اداری (اتوماسیون گردش مکاتبات) متخصص می‎باشند. برخی از وظایف پشتیبان نرم افزار به صورت زیر می‎باشد:

آشنایی با شغل کارشناس پشتیبانی و استقرار نرم افزار

کارشناسان پشتیبانی و استقرار نرم افزار در شرکت‎ها‎‎ی نرم افزاری مشغول کار می‎باشند و وظایفی از جمله نصب، پیاده سازی، اجرا و آموزش نرم افزارهای تولیدی آن شرکت را بر عهده دارند. تخصص این کارشناسان تأثیر زیادی در میزان موفقیت پروژه‎ها‎‎ی نرم افزاری و همچنین کاربران دارد.

اگر چه کارشناس پشتیبانی و استقرار به صورت تمام وقت کار می‎کند اما در عین حال دارای ساعت کاری منعطف هستند. محل کار آنها از یک پروژه به پروژه دیگر تفاوت دارد و برای انجام وظایف خود مرتباً در حال سفر و مأموریت‎ها‎‎ی درون شهری و بین شهری می‎باشد.

دانش و مهارت مورد نیاز برای پشتیبانی و استقرار نرم افزار

  • توانایی حل مساله
  • داشتن دقت کافی به جزئیات
  • مهارت برقراری ارتباط مناسب
  • مهارت آموزش دادن به دیگران
  • برخورداری از روحیه کار گروهی
  • تسلط کافی بر نرم افزارهای مرتبط
  • توانایی تصمیم‎گیری به موقع و درست
  • علاقه به حوزه فناوری اطلاعات و کامپیوتر
  • داشتن پتانسیل مدیریت شرایط پراسترس کاری
  • برخوردار بودن از هوش هیجانی بالا، قوه خلاقیت
  • توانایی ارائه خدمات مؤثر بدون نیاز به حضور مستقیم مدیر
  • توانایی برقراری ارتباط ِدیداری و نوشتاری مثل مهارت شنیداری، گفتاری و نوشتاری
  • توانایی آنالیز خدمات ارائه ‌شده و به‌کارگیری آن‌ها در اصلاح فرایندها و جلوگیری از تکرار دوباره آن‌ها
  • داشتن دانش سخت‌افزاری و نرم ‌افزاری لازم برای ارائه خدمات و ثبت گزارش‌ها، ترجیحاً دارای دارای مدرک دانشگاهی مرتبط با سیستمی
  • توانایی مدیریت شرایط مختلف کاری، مانند استفاده بهینه از زمان در بازه‌های زمانی کم‌ تماس، و توانایی تمرکز برای انجام چند فعالیت هم‌زمان در بازه‌های زمانی پرمشغله

وظایف کارشناس پشتیبانی و استقرار نرم افزار آسان محاسبِ ارقام سیستم

  • رفت و آمد به مکان مشتری
  • انجام تنظیمات اولیه نرم افزار
  • خوش برخورد بودن و صبوری
  • نصب نرم افزار بر روی کامپیوتر یا سرور
  • ارائه گزارش‎ها‎‎ی دوره‎ای به مدیریت پروژه
  • ارائه نظرات تخصصی جهت اجرای بهتر نرم افزار
  • دانش عمومی در زمینه کامپیوتر، سیستم عامل، نرم افزار، سخت افزار
  • ساخت و یا متناسب سازی فرم‎ها‎‎ و گزارش‎ها‎‎ی خاص مورد نیاز مشتری
  • انجام کارهای عمومی با پایگاه داده (بکاپ، restore یا اجرای query)
  • تخصص در حوزه دستورات command line سیستم عامل‎ها‎‎ همچون لینوکس و ویندوز
  • راهنمایی کاربران برای استفاده صحیح از نرم افزار و رفع مشکلات احتمالی آنها در حین انجام کار
  • آموزش کاربران در رابطه با چگونگی کار با نرم افزار، أخذ گزارش‎ها‎‎ و روش برخورد با خطاهای احتمالی
  • کسب تأییدیه انجام کار از کاربران به منظور تکمیل پرونده پروژه استقرار نرم افزار و مستند کردن مراحل مختلف انجام کار
admin
ارسال دیدگاه

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*